167. Belgian School, circa 19th Century


Peasant Girl. Sanguine image of a country lass on laid paper, framed under glass. Image unsigned. Paper measures apprx 11-1/2"H x 4-1/2"W. Verso bears brief information on image. With cloth liner and gold-leafed frame, entire item measures apprx 19"H x 12"W. Provenance: Ex-coll dealer Thomas French then a prominent Cleveland, Ohio estate.

350/500 Sold: $345.00

Joseph Laing (American, circa 19th Century)

169. Joseph Laing (American, circa 19th Century)


"Raising the Liberty Pole". Hand colored engraving on paper, framed under glass. Festive scene depicts a colonial community affair. "Dedicated to the American People, the Centenary of Independence, Commemorative of 1776". Painted by F.A. Chaplin and engraved by John C. McRae, N.Y. Copyright by Joseph Laing, 1886. Image measures apprx 18-1/4"H x 27-1/4"W. In cream mat and wood frame, measures apprx 29-1/2"H x 37"W. Sticker on verso from Kennedy & Co. Rare Prints, New York.

400/600 Sold: $172.50

Max Bohm (American, 1868-1923)

171. Max Bohm (American, 1868-1923)


Good Morning. Black and white chalk on gray paper, framed under glass. Sketch depicts a woman in her dressing gown greeting her husband who is reading the newspaper. Lines are light and few shapes have been fleshed out. Signed on lower left and dated, 1889. Paper measures apprx 15-1/2"H x 13"W.

150/300 Sold: $132.25
